Get started15 Bourne Street is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Woodsetton, Dudley, Dudley (DY3 1AF). It has a recorded floor area of 105 m² (around 1131 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(September 2011) shows a C (score 73). The latest certificate is from September 2011,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Sale prices here have outpaced Dudley HPI: 5.9%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£271,000 sits 54.9% above the 2016 sale of £175,000.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2006.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 105 m² it's 25.1% larger than the typical home in the postcode (84 m² median across 6 EPCs).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 83% of similar EPCs). Last changed hands 10 years ago, in July 2016.
